Promises Kept!


I made a number of promises to you when I ran in 2006, and I've kept those promises.

I promised to show up in Concord and promote common sense solutions.

One of the reasons I ran was because of the poor attendance records of our previous Representatives. I've proud of keeping that promise. Over the last two years, I've never missed a session day. I've voted in more that 99% of roll call votes, and out of Manchester's 35 Representatives, no one has a better record then I do.

I promised to vote against a sales or income tax.
I promised to work to keep spending and taxes under control.

I voted against an income tax, which was overwhelmingly killed by a voice vote. Although a general sales tax didn't come up this session, I voted against new and higher taxes on gasoline, milk, bottles, and fuel oil, among others.

I promised to fight to protect your privacy and civil liberties.

I'm very proud of my record of fighting to protect our privacy and civil liberties. I co-sponsored the legislation that opted our state out of the Federal REAL ID Act, a national ID card system. I was the only Representative who objected to an amendment that would have prohibited many write-in votes in local elections from being counted - and my case against it was persuasive enough that the whole House overturned the committee's recommendation. Just a few weeks ago, the Union Leader's State House Dome column gave me co-credit for stopping a bill that would have created a state database of our prescription drug use. Of course, I've lost some fights too, but I've been up there working hard.

I promised to work to protect our environment.

I've kept that promise by supporting legislation that established Renewable Portfolio Standards (RPS) for power companies, and voting to have New Hampshire join the Regional Greenhouse Gas Initiative.

I promised to work for safer neighborhoods.

We've taken a step in that direction with legislation that provides for stricter sentences for gang members.
